About Your Role
The Juniper Square engineering team is growing fast. As an Engineering Manager, you will build, lead, and develop engineering teams that can deliver a rapidly evolving software platform.
Your role is to collaborate with the leadership team to deliver on these objectives and support teams throughout execution of both engineering and product roadmap projects, while setting and maintaining a high standard.
Specifically, you will:
- Be a leader on the team, influencing and empowering others to do their best work
- Collaborate with engineering leaders and technical recruiting teams to refine our hiring process and build a high-caliber engineering team
- Partner closely with the product and business teams to define and prioritize roadmap requirements
- Guide the planning process and effectively communicate with stakeholders to identify and resolve dependencies
- Provide context to your team and drive alignment towards the business objectives
- Support engineering teams in building and deliver high quality software, leveraging your software engineering expertise
- Build quality relationships team members, including direct reports, technical leaders, and other managers
- Coach and guide the development of engineers on your team
Qualifications
- 3+ years of experience managing engineering teams
- Effective written and verbal communication skills and a strong ability to articulate complex ideas at both a conceptual and deeply technical level
- Proven ability to collaborate with product managers and engineers to build plans, set expectations, and successfully deliver projects
- A strong technical background with a solid understanding of web applications and data modeling
